Transaction 5978a87edc62c4d1ceb53e4aba9960050a0660e83148a7a8fc4b739c68ab2c7e
1 Input
1 Output
-
5978a87edc62c4d1ceb53e4aba9960050a0660e83148a7a8fc4b739c68ab2c7e:0
- value
- 354745249
- script pubkey
- OP_0 OP_PUSHBYTES_20 743974c9fc11b24fcc3691547825c88c77024516
- address
- bc1qwsuhfj0uzxeylnpkj928sfwg33msy3gky8xrhm